Different species have different levels of transformation. Some, like dogs, cats, and cows, have entirely replaced heads. Others, like angels and succubi, have accessories like wings or horns, and still others, like the zombie, just have alternate skin textures.
Species Transition
Species is no longer all-or-nothing. The new fetish interview at the start of the game now determines how extreme a species can be (ranging from "just ears" to "the whole nine yards"). The secondary species will creep in from the extremities, so a 50% transformed slave may have fur or scales on the arms and legs, but not on the torso.
A slave's species can also be changed over time using serum, which can be manufactured in the new Serum Fabricator furniture in the slave quarters. Building the fabricator will unlock a new panel on the slave information screen.
Skin Patterns
Characters can now have multiple skin colors, following a set of tone maps. Because a slave can also be split between multiple species, that means that up to four skin colors can be used on a character, and all can be adjusted through the surgery center.
